In a setback for Aam Aadmi Party, 15 Councillors in Municipal Corporation of Delhi (MCD) have resigned from the party’s membership and announced the formation of a new party.
The councillors led by Himani Jain and Mukesh Goel, flagged internal conflicts behind their resignation. They formed a new political party named Indraprastha Vikas Party.
Himani Jain and Mukesh Goel stated that no significant work had been completed in the municipal corporation over the past two-and-a-half years due to internal conflicts.
They said, a new party has been formed because they want to work for the development of Delhi and will support any party which will work for the development of the national capital.
